Output 40ca908ae755d77251401798f4fcecdacb43757bf8f050b8c3c5df582c60a1e1:0

value
23909889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bcb0b822d1565a1b0e551197930effef4f6a5b OP_EQUAL
address
MAFFAf9UKs7oDQj9hE7nMwaw47QmUtopNh
transaction
40ca908ae755d77251401798f4fcecdacb43757bf8f050b8c3c5df582c60a1e1
spent
true